Who we areThe Payroll Division provides a payroll service to teaching and non-teaching staff in primary, voluntary secondary and community and comprehensive schools. Retired personnel are also paid through this service. What we do- Co-ordination and administration of a range of payroll services to:
- Primary, voluntary secondary and community and comprehensive school teachers
- Special needs assistants in primary, voluntary secondary and community and comprehensive schools
- Clerical officers under the 1978 scheme in primary and voluntary secondary schools
- Caretakers employed under the 1978 scheme in primary schools
- Childcare workers in primary schools
- Retired primary, voluntary secondary and community and comprehensive school teachers, including spouses and children of deceased staff
- Retired special needs assistants, caretakers and clerical officers employed under the 1978 scheme and childcare workers including spouses and children of deceased staff
- Management of statutory and non-statutory deductions
- Projection of financial estimates for the funding of the approved allocations for serving and retired staff members paid on the Department’s payroll and monitoring expenditure on an ongoing basis.
- Supporting the delivery of payroll services by quality planning and policy formulation.
